## Onboarding: Examshade Proctoring Queue

As security reviewer, you will audit how the Examshade queue assigns proctors and retains session flags. Access to the queue's encrypted review archive requires unsealing the Dovemarsh vault during your first rotation. Complete the access training module first. The vault's recovery passphrase is recorded immediately below for your reference.

recovery phrase for fawif-tajeg: norael-aldmir-casir-brivan-ulaion

# WanderEar Audio Guide — Runbook

Welcome aboard! WanderEar serves audio tours for the Fennimore Gallery app. Most pages you'll get are about stalled audio downloads — nine times out of ten it's the CDN cache going stale after a content push. Fix: trigger a cache purge from the Ops console, wait five minutes, verify with a test download. If exhibits show out of order, the manifest sync job probably died; restart it. Full procedures and dashboards live on the internal page below.

operations page: https://jenkins.zemvarcloud.local/job/merge_requests/repo/build/73930b4b30f0a8ed

## 2.9.1 — Key rotation

Rotated release signing key following parity audit between the Brindle SDK (Kotlin) and the Sorrel SDK (Swift). Both clients now expose identical retry, pagination, and telemetry surfaces; divergence tracked closed. Old key revoked; builds signed after this entry will not verify against it. Future maintainers: re-run the parity matrix before any further rotation. New key follows.

signing key of fahag-tadug = bky9_XH2KCQnPM

Dear executive team,

Ahead of next week's review, please find the summary for the Eastbrook region. Revenue reached 94% of target, with the Solvane platform outperforming and the Quillard accessories line lagging. I have asked Marit, our incoming director, to take particular note of the channel mix shifts in the Dunhollow territory, as these will shape her first-quarter priorities. Detailed figures follow in the attachment. Before reviewing those, please read the confidential note below carefully.

management briefing: Project Ulavan slips by two quarters because of the staffing delay.